Overview

Varenyam Achal is affiliated with the Guangdong Technion-Israel Institute of Technology in China. Their research primarily focuses on environmental science, with a total of 43 publications in this area. Within this broad field, Achal has contributed significantly to several subfields including environmental engineering, pollution, materials chemistry, biomaterials, and civil and structural engineering.

The scientist's work covers a broad range of topics relevant to environmental science and sustainable materials. Their main research topics include:

  • Microbial Applications in Construction Materials
  • Calcium Carbonate Crystallization and Inhibition
  • Corrosion Behavior and Inhibition
  • Microbial Fuel Cells and Bioremediation
  • Enzyme Function and Inhibition
  • Building Materials and Conservation
  • Microplastics and Plastic Pollution

Varenyam Achal has authored recent work published in various peer-reviewed journals. Notable papers include:

  • "Environmental and health impacts due to e-waste disposal in China - A review," 2020, The Science of The Total Environment
  • "A comprehensive review on environmental and human health impacts of chemical pesticide usage," 2024, Emerging Contaminants
  • "The Utilization of Agricultural Waste as Agro-Cement in Concrete: A Review," 2020, Sustainability
  • "Biosurfactants: Eco-Friendly and Innovative Biocides against Biocorrosion," 2020, International Journal of Molecular Sciences
  • "Impact of the COVID-19 pandemic on air pollution in Chinese megacities from the perspective of traffic volume and meteorological factors," 2021, The Science of The Total Environment

Their frequent coauthors reflect ongoing collaborations with other researchers in related fields. These include Shubhangi D. Shirsat, Weila Li, Chaolin Fang, Deepika Kumari, and Mahendra Rai.

Publications by Achal have appeared repeatedly in prominent scientific venues. The most frequent journals include:

  • The Science of The Total Environment
  • Journal of Environmental Management
  • Sustainability
  • Environmental Microbiology Reports
  • Emerging Contaminants
